King Charles Issues Ultimatum to Prince Harry Amid Royal Reconciliation Rumors

The strained relationship between King Charles and his youngest son, Prince Harry, appears far from resolved despite recent glimpses of reconciliation. Following Prince Harry’s departure from royal duties and the publication of his memoir Spare, tensions have remained high.

During Harry’s recent visit to the UK, which marked their first meeting in 19 months, The Times reports that King Charles issued a clear ultimatum: there can be no “half-in, half-out” approach to royal life. This aligns with the late Queen Elizabeth II’s 2020 decision that royals cannot hold public roles while simultaneously pursuing private business ventures.

For Harry, this means relinquishing lucrative deals with Netflix and Spotify, among others, if he wishes to re-engage formally with royal duties. The King is unwilling to grant any special exceptions to his son, maintaining strict adherence to royal protocol.

A spokesperson for Prince Harry noted that the Duke’s focus remains on his father and declined further comment on family matters. While courtiers discuss more frequent meetings aimed at projecting unity, a full public return for Harry remains uncertain.
